Question 884531: solve each system by the addition method.
5x+4y=12
7x-6y=40
put your answer in ordered pair (x,y) form

(5x+4y=12)3=>15x+12y=36
(7x-6y=40)2=>14x-12y=80
by adding two equations, we get
29x=116
=>x=4
and
5(4)+4y=12
=>4y=12-20
=>4y=-8
=>y=-2
(x,y)=(4,-2)
